What is Financial Planning?

Before we dive deeper into the topic, let’s first understand what financial planning is. Financial planning is the process of creating a comprehensive plan to help individuals meet their financial goals. These goals could be anything from saving for retirement, buying a house, paying off debts, or simply creating a budget. The aim of financial planning is to ensure that individuals have a clear understanding of their finances and a strategy to achieve their financial goals.

Why is Financial Planning Important?

There are numerous reasons why registering for financial planning is important. Let’s take a closer look at some of the key reasons:

1. Helps in Creating a Financial Roadmap

Financial planning helps individuals create a financial roadmap that outlines their short-term and long-term financial goals. This roadmap acts as a guide to help individuals stay focused and on track towards achieving their financial objectives.

2. Enables Better Financial Management

One of the significant benefits of financial planning is that it enables you to manage your finances better. Through proper financial planning, you can understand your income, expenses, debts, and assets. This, in turn, helps in creating a budget, reducing expenses, and increasing savings.

3. Provides Financial Security

Financial planning can provide financial security to individuals by helping them plan for unexpected expenses such as medical emergencies, job loss, or any other unforeseen expenditure. Having a financial plan in place can help individuals avoid financial hardships during tough times.

4. Helps in Tax Planning

Another crucial benefit of financial planning is that it helps individuals plan for taxes. By understanding the tax implications of different investment options, individuals can make informed decisions that help them save money on taxes.

5. Encourages Investments

Finally, financial planning can encourage individuals to invest their money in a variety of investment options such as stocks, bonds, or mutual funds. By doing so, individuals can grow their wealth and achieve their financial goals faster.
